Avery is anything but content with his life. He’s been thinking outside of the box, weirdly so, since he was little. Challenging figures of authority on their morals, refusing communication with almost all of his classmates, rambling on about conspiracy theories. A real annoyance. It only got worse since his parents divorced. Since then, he’s buried himself in his weirdness and hasn’t seemed to recover even though it’s been three years.
He doesn’t have any friends, and instead spends his time getting to know book characters by analyzing their dialogue and behavior, brushing off the callings of the human world.

On one fateful day, when it was Avery’s weekend to live with his mom, he got into an argument with her. She stated he was never going to get anywhere in life if he didn’t learn how to talk to people, and began to throw away his things that she considered “too weird” for a teen his age.
When she left for work, he hurriedly looked through the trash to see what he could salvage. Frowning, he notices he’d lost his favorite ring. A silver band with black detailing in the form of stars along the metal.

However, his eyes caught something shiny on the ground a few feet away from his mom’s house. The ring! He walked over to go pick it up, when suddenly a giant brown-reddish colored dog wearing a bone skull-mask picked the ring up in its mouth and ran back into the forest around his mom’s house. Another strange thing about the dog, was that the tip of its tail was just bone.
Trailing after it, he finds himself running into the direction of the rumored ‘haunted cabin’ in the middle of the woods. When the dog ran through it, he followed.
Finding himself in an unfamiliar place that was anything but the inside of an abandoned cabin.
